Saiki ermöglicht es Entwicklern, KI-Agenten in YAML zu beschreiben, Multi-Agenten-Workflows zu orchestrieren, externe APIs zu integrieren und Ausführungsprotokolle zu überwachen. Es unterstützt benutzerdefinierte Code-Plugins, parametrische Eingabeaufforderungen, Wiederholungslogik und Bereitstellung über RESTful-Endpunkte, sodass Teams autonome Agenten mit voller Nachverfolgbarkeit und Leistungskennzahlen testen und skalieren können.
Saiki ermöglicht es Entwicklern, KI-Agenten in YAML zu beschreiben, Multi-Agenten-Workflows zu orchestrieren, externe APIs zu integrieren und Ausführungsprotokolle zu überwachen. Es unterstützt benutzerdefinierte Code-Plugins, parametrische Eingabeaufforderungen, Wiederholungslogik und Bereitstellung über RESTful-Endpunkte, sodass Teams autonome Agenten mit voller Nachverfolgbarkeit und Leistungskennzahlen testen und skalieren können.
Saiki ist ein Open-Source-Agent-Orchestrierungsframework, das Entwicklern die Erstellung komplexer KI-gesteuerter Workflows durch deklarative YAML-Definitionen ermöglicht. Jeder Agent kann Aufgaben ausführen, externe Dienste aufrufen oder andere Agenten in einer Kette ansteuern. Saiki bietet einen integrierten REST-API-Server, Ausführungstracing, detaillierte Protokolle und ein webbasiertes Dashboard für die Echtzeitüberwachung. Es unterstützt Wiederholungen, Fallbacks und benutzerdefinierte Erweiterungen, was das Iterieren, Debuggen und Skalieren robuster Automatisierungs-Pipelines erleichtert.
Wer wird Saiki verwenden?
KI/ML-Entwickler
Softwareingenieure
Automatisierungsingenieure
KI-Forscher
Produktmanager
Wie verwendet man Saiki?
Schritt 1: Installieren Sie Saiki über npm oder pip.
Schritt 2: Schreiben Sie Agentendefinitionen und Workflows in einer YAML-Datei.
Schritt 3: Konfigurieren Sie externe API-Integrationen und benutzerdefinierte Plugins.
Schritt 4: Starten Sie den Saiki-Server, um REST-Endpunkte bereitzustellen.
Schritt 5: Überwachen Sie die Ausführung und Protokolle über das Web-Dashboard oder CLI.
Schritt 6: Passen Sie YAML-Konfigurationen an und deployen Sie bei Bedarf neu.
Plattform
web
mac
windows
linux
Die Kernfunktionen und Vorteile von Saiki
Die Hauptfunktionen
YAML-basierte Agenten- und Workflow-Definitionen
Multi-Agenten-Orchestrierung und Verkettung
Integration externer APIs
REST-API-Server für Deployment
Ausführungstracing und detaillierte Protokollierung
Wiederholungs- und Fallback-Mechanismen
Unterstützung für benutzerdefinierten Code und Plugins
Web-basiertes Überwachungs-Dashboard
Die Vorteile
Beschleunigt die Entwicklung automatisierter Agentenprozesse
Verbessert Transparenz und Debugging von Workflows
Vereinfachte Integration externer Dienste
Ermöglicht skalierbaren Einsatz über REST-Endpunkte
Bietet Erweiterbarkeit durch Plugins und Code-Hooks
Stellt Echtzeitüberwachung und Leistungsmetriken bereit